Mr. Owens devotes his practice solely to representing plaintiffs in private damage and wrongful demise claims. His primary awareness is automobile/tractor-trailer injuries, canine bites, slip/journey and falls, scientific malpractice, injuries from dangerous merchandise, activity accidents and nursing home abuse.
Before joining forces with Mr. Mulherin to open Owens & Mulherin in 2001, Mr. Owens worked for Bouhan, Williams and Levy, LLP, from 1986 to 2000 in civil litigation. Mr. Owens is the former President of the Savannah Trial Lawyers Association.
Mr. Owens and his wife stay in Savannah, Georgia and raised their kids in Savannah. Mr. Owens is an avid bicycle rider and loves animals. Thus, he has constantly been interested by representing cyclists who've been struck via automobiles and those who've been bitten by using dogs which might be either no longer on a leash or are not constrained to their backyard.
